How To Shop Second Hand Designer Merchandise

By Barbara Brown


In the free market economy, sellers are free to buy and sell merchandise that consumers want at a certain price. At the same time, the consumers would like to get the best quality products at reasonable prices, hence the need for the used items. Some would like to buy such items for their use and yet others resale them at a higher price enabling them to make a profit. The following are the best ideas on effective shopping of second hand designer merchandise.

Know when the store will have new stock. Knowing when the new stocks are coming can help get the best quality items. There might be a wide variety to choose from. Call your preferred store and ask on the dates and time that you may visit to be the first one to pick the best selection. First pickers always take the cream of the items that arrive.

Make a list of what to buy. It pays to know the kind of outfit you are going to buy. There are quite a wide variety of products that one can buy, including those that are not necessary. Making a list helps avoid impulsive buying since most things might be appealing to the eye. Generate a list and go to the specific sections that such items are.

Never have a fixed mind concerning the brand of items to purchase. It is true that stores which stock such merchandise get them from different manufacturers. It is therefore almost impossible to find one that sells specific ones. To be on the safe side, do not limit yourself on the brand type but be free to get a wide variety.

Overlook the labels. The labels may sometimes fool buyers, and they end up buying what is not the right one. An item can have a fancy label that might be fake. Some put the labels there to increase sales of fake products, and do not be a victim. Purchase something after looking at it thoroughly and liking it rather than considering the labels.

Consider the current fashion and quality. Some pieces of clothing might be of big sizes that may end up not fitting you. Others might also come from an old era which may end up making you look like somebody from another generation. Do not take outdated things even if they are enticing.

Check on the price and any discounts available. The price charged is another big thing that one should consider when going shopping. The used items go for less money compared to the brand new ones. Ask to know if quantity discounts are available when you buy a certain quantity of products.

The secret of buying the best outfit is going to the store while having information about where to start the selection. The above tips are essential to help someone make the right selection in the shortest time possible. Ensure that you remain committed to getting the right outfit at a reasonable cost.
